I got the ECT cats from ebay for $100 each plus $15 for shipping (Arizona to CA) from seller ppe. Email him and ask for a multi-buy discount. The install cost me $350 cash (see my other thread), and worth every penny. AAA performance exhaust did a fantastic job. The trick is to get the new exhaust tucked up as far as possible, and avoid using the pipe-squishing technique and 90-degree bends that the factory does. You can go with full secondary cat delete, but you won't pick up much HP by doing so and the secondaries aid in refining the sound of the exhaust IMO. Here is an info link to ECT metallic cats.

Weather conditions probably stole 2 to 4 HP I figure + or -. Then grossed up to get to crank HP is about 12 to 14 HP. Which is in line with the original goal; 40% to 60% of the gains of long-tube headers for 20% of the cost. It was a cost benefit/noise/staying green analysis for me; I was not searching for the last drop of HP. Yes, long tubes will deliver more HP, but at a far greater cost (and noise) and will require a complete rework of the rest of the exhaust system.
The increase (upfronted and increased) in torque was the biggest improvement, and it is what you feel first and foremost since the torque curve comes on much stronger and earlier now. Difficult to hook up in 1st gear now when I give it heavier throttle. Also want to note that the scaling on the graph is off. The left hand side is scaled to 320 while the right hand side is scaled at 465, so the intersect of HP to RPM is not at the 5,250 where it should be. All in cost was not too bad:
AMS Headers; I preordered the headers way back in summer so I got a bit of a discount, but I think the list price is around $1,500 now - check with AMS Mardikian Automotive install of headers; $300 - about 3.5 hours labor 200-cell ECT Metallic Cats on Ebay; $200 AAA Performance Exhaust install of cats with custom piping; $350 cash price So only $1,700 on parts at full list price. As opposed to Supersprint headers and cats which are a whopping $5,000 before install add in mufflers and you are up to $6,600. And you run the risk of not passing smog in CA and the car sounding like a Messerschmitt BF 109 fighting over Calais. Also want to note that AMS' customer service is top notch. He always kept me informed of manufacturing progress, timing etc. He also went well out of his way to help me chose the appropriate cats and overall exhaust layout. He steered me away from useless mods and mods that would make the car too loud for my taste such as an x-pipe or aftermarket resonator. The results are as expected in HP improvement, but well in excess of expectations on sound improvement and torque improvement. I really have to thank AMS for that.
